Summary
1071. Nigel of Cotentin 1st Baron of Halton created.
1080. Son William Fitznigel 2nd Baron of Halton succeeded.
1134. Son William Fitzwilliam 3rd Baron of Halton succeeded.
1134. Eustace Fitzjohn 4th Baron Halton 1088-1157 succeeded.
10th July 1157. Son Richard Fitzeustace 5th Baron of Halton succeeded.
1163. Son John Fitzrichard 6th Baron Halton succeeded.
11th October 1190. Son Roger Lacy 6th Baron Pontefract 7th Baron Halton succeeded.
1st October 1211. Son John Lacy Earl Lincoln succeeded.
22nd July 1240. Son Edmund Lacy 8th Baron Pontefract, 9th Baron Halton succeeded.
1258. Son Henry Lacy 4th Earl Lincoln, Earl Salisbury succeeded.
February 1311. Daughter Alice Lacy Countess Leicester, and Lancaster 5th Countess of Salisbury 5th Countess Lincoln succeeded.
2nd October 1348. Alice Lacy Countess Leicester, and Lancaster 5th Countess of Salisbury 5th Countess Lincoln extinct.
In 1071 Nigel of Cotentin 1st Baron of Halton was created 1st Baron Halton.
In 1080 Nigel of Cotentin 1st Baron of Halton died. His son William succeeded 2nd Baron Halton.
In 1134 William Fitznigel 2nd Baron of Halton died. His son William succeeded 3rd Baron Halton.
In or after 1134 William Fitzwilliam 3rd Baron of Halton died. His brother-in-law (age 46) succeeded 4th Baron Halton.
On 10th July 1157 (age 69) died at Saxlingham WalsIngham, Norfolk. His son Richard (age 37) succeeded 5th Baron Halton.
Around 1163 Richard Fitzeustace 5th Baron of Halton (age 43) died. His son John (age 19) succeeded 6th Baron Halton. Alice Mandeville Baroness Halton by marriage Baroness Halton.
On 11th October 1190 John Fitzrichard 6th Baron Halton (age 46) died at Tyre. His son Roger (age 19) succeeded 7th Baron Halton. Maud Clere Baroness Lacy Baroness Warkworth by marriage Baroness Halton.
On 1st October 1211 Roger Lacy 6th Baron Pontefract 7th Baron Halton (age 40) died in Pontefract [Map].
John Lacy Earl Lincoln (age 19) succeeded 8th Baron Halton, 7th Baron Pontefract. Alice Aquila Baroness Bowland, Halton and Lacy by marriage Baroness Halton, Baroness Pontefract.
In 1221 John Lacy Earl Lincoln (age 29) and Margaret Quincy 3rd Countess Lincoln and Pembroke (age 15) were married. She by marriage Baroness Halton, Baroness Pontefract. She the daughter of Robert Quincy Earl Lincoln and Hawise Gernon 2nd Countess Lincoln (age 41).
On 22nd July 1240 John Lacy Earl Lincoln (age 48) died. His son Edmund (age 10) succeeded 8th Baron Pontefract, 9th Baron Halton.
In 1258 Edmund Lacy 8th Baron Pontefract, 9th Baron Halton (age 28) died. His son Henry (age 7) succeeded 9th Baron Pontefract, 10th Baron Halton.
In February 1311 Henry Lacy 4th Earl Lincoln, Earl Salisbury (age 60) died at Lincoln's Inn. His daughter Alice (age 29) succeeded 5th Countess Salisbury, 5th Countess Lincoln, 10th Baroness Pontefract, 11th Baroness Halton. Thomas Plantagenet 2nd Earl of Leicester, 2nd Earl Lancaster, Earl of Salisbury and Lincoln (age 33) by marriage Earl Salisbury, Earl Lincoln.
On 2nd October 1348 Alice Lacy Countess Leicester, and Lancaster 5th Countess of Salisbury 5th Countess Lincoln (age 66) died without issue at Barlings Abbey [Map]. Earl Salisbury, Earl Lincoln, Baron Pontefract and Baron Halton extinct.
